Transaction 0663af5fc125071eeca08410fc5ee84ccccb396db836176195cbfe5317eadb08
1 Input
2 Outputs
- 0663af5fc125071eeca08410fc5ee84ccccb396db836176195cbfe5317eadb08:0
- 0663af5fc125071eeca08410fc5ee84ccccb396db836176195cbfe5317eadb08:1
value 4058455748
address 115qZBCxfKKemWLW7FnjkN9reRsgePU8ci
value 406179404
address 1KJSbEkXvjRywTpbA7u32sndx5a9gbRyp9